This braided basket has a unique look since each basket is handmade.

You can choose how you want to use this basket – turned up with handles or turned down to display the contents.

Collecting your belongings in baskets make it easier to keep organised and find what you’re looking for.

Seagrass is a material with natural colour variations which are affected by where and when the plant grows and the prevailing weather conditions when the plant is harvested.

What is sedge (or seagrass)?

Sedge (or seagrass) grows naturally in South-East Asian coastal areas. For our products, we mainly use cultivated sedge from field areas that have previously been flooded by the sea, making them unsuitable for rice cultivation. But sedge grows well in salty soils and even helps cleanse them. After harvest, the plant is left to dry in the sun making it a hardwearing fibre ideal for weaving or braiding products with beautiful colour variations, like baskets and mats.
